HP 8711C-13C USER – Device Overview

The HP 8711C-13C USER is a precision RF and microwave signal analyzer designed for advanced testing and measurement applications. Ideal for engineers and technicians, this device provides accurate frequency, power, and modulation analysis across a wide range of frequencies. Its robust design and user-friendly interface make it suitable for both laboratory and field environments.

Basic Usage and Operation Tips

Before powering on the HP 8711C-13C USER, ensure all connections are secure and the device is properly grounded. Use the front panel controls to select the desired measurement mode and frequency range. Calibrate the device regularly using the built-in calibration routines to maintain measurement accuracy. When analyzing signals, start with a broad frequency sweep and narrow down to specific frequencies for detailed inspection.

Troubleshooting and Maintenance

If the device fails to power on, check the power supply and fuse condition. For inconsistent measurements, verify calibration status and perform recalibration if necessary. Keep the device clean and free of dust by wiping with a soft, dry cloth. Avoid exposing the instrument to extreme temperatures or humidity to prevent damage. For persistent issues, consult the user manual or contact HP technical support.
